Development Works Food posts 19% profit rise to SAR 2.5M in H1 2025; Q2 at SAR 1.1M

Development Works Food Co. posted a net profit of SAR 2.5 million for the first half of 2025, up 19% from SAR 2.1 million in H1 2024.



Financials (M)

Item 6m 2024 6m 2025 Change‬
Revenues 50.06 55.92 11.7 %
Gross Income 4.50 6.68 48.5 %
Operating Income 1.02 1.66 62.7 %
Net Income 2.11 2.51 18.7 %
Average Shares 3.00 3.00 -
Earnings Per Share before unusual items (Riyals) 0.70 0.84 18.7 %
EPS (Riyal) 0.70 0.84 18.7 %

This was driven by higher revenues year-on-year due to strong sales from the Juice Time brand.

 

In Q2 2025, the company’s bottom line dropped 23% to SAR 1.1 million, from SAR 1.42 million in Q2 2024. This was due to recording an additional provision for expected credit losses, paired with a decline in other income and an increase in general and administrative expenses.

 

Sequentially, net income plunged by 23.2% from SAR 1.42 million in Q1 2025.

Shareholders' equity (after minority interest) reached SAR 24.78 million by the end of H1 2025, up from SAR 23.35 million in the year-earlier period.

 

Accumulated losses amounted to SAR 5.7 million by the end of June 30, 2025, representing 19.13% of capital.
